Output 6523702fb5b41f88a230601adaff6dd23ca4f92a24aa6eb19bfbea6cca1274ee:0

value
501264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fab24d7a15ea1ff4c82bb7aad7aec732c904788 OP_EQUAL
address
3Ld4pYHzdv88RaLCUVauhR2wpWdErhnurG
transaction
6523702fb5b41f88a230601adaff6dd23ca4f92a24aa6eb19bfbea6cca1274ee
spent
true